Visible Fictions Artistic Producer Douglas Irvine files the first of his tales from America where initial work has begun on the Company's co-production with Minneapolis Children's Theatre Company.
I’m here! After what felt like the longest journey ever I’ve arrived and settled in Minneapolis. I was met by Nancy at the airport who held one of those placards with my name on it. I felt like I was in a film!! I’d been in contact with Nancy a few times - by email and phone - so to meet her face to face was so lovely even after 15 hours of travelling.
I’m staying directly across from the theatre so have excuses for being late in the morning ;-) and I’m feeling quite excited and nervous about going in there. I’m meeting lots of actors and various designers for the first time this week. Mostly I’m looking forward to meeting up with Peter (the Artistic Director) and Elissa (New Play Development
Director) who together with VF have been hatching this crazy plan to create a production of Peter Pan between our companies. I’m also looking forward to meeting with Jim (the General Manager). We’ve spoken loads and laughed lots too but I have no idea what he looks like. I wonder if he’ll be like I imagine!
